Front

What is a unit rate?

Back

A unit rate is a comparison of two different quantities where one of the quantities is expressed as a quantity of one. For example, 60 miles per hour is a unit rate because it describes miles traveled in one hour.

Front

Which of the following is a unit rate? 70 miles per hour, 15 pages per 20 minutes, $15 per pound, 1000 meters per kilometer?

Back

70 miles per hour and $15 per pound are unit rates. 15 pages per 20 minutes is not a unit rate because it does not express a quantity per one unit of time.

Front

How do you calculate a unit rate?

Back

To calculate a unit rate, divide the first quantity by the second quantity to find out how much of the first quantity corresponds to one unit of the second quantity.

Front

If a realtor visits 12 houses in 3 hours, what is the unit rate in houses per hour?

Back

4 houses per hour.
